Hayden Martin Coe, Jr. age 94, passed away on June 1, 2026. He was born on December 4, 1931. A resident of Texarkana, Arkansas, Hayden’s life reflected steady dedication, quiet courage, and a generous spirit that touched those who had the privilege of knowing him. He was a U.S. Marine Veteran who served in the Korean War. Proud member of the American Legion. Loved spending time with his daughter Melissa and grandchildren and great-grandchildren.
Preceded in death by his wives Laura Coe, Catherine Coe, son Gary Coe and grandson Tim Coe as well as a Son-in-law Jay Fricks.
Survived by his daughter Melissa Fricks (Rusty Musgrove); one step daughter Rynne Belk and two grandchildren Haleigh Rice (Nick) and Hunter Cox (Allie) plus five great-grandchildren Landan, Tatem, Brinkley Coe and Sophia and Gabriel Rice; special daughter-in-law Sandra Coe.
